ICT function at Centrepoint

Courtesy of Sunday Bulletin

11 November 2001

 

 

The annual ICT School Based Committee end of year function was held at the Centrepoint Hotel on November 9. The function was officiated by the Assistant Director of Schools, Yang Mulia Cikgu Hj. Bujang Bin Hj Masu'ut.

 

Also present were Principal and Deputy Principal of SMPDSM, the Chairman and Workshop Coordinator, Mr Chong Jon Fong, Workshop Facilitators Cikgu Hj Ali Sofian Hj Thani, as well as Heads of Departments and participants from schools throughout Brunei Darussalam. Twenty-two teachers received certificates of attendance from the Assistant Director of Schools. The multimedia workshop was conducted in three sessions (18 October, 25 October and 8 November 2001) at SM Pehin Datu Seri Maharaja.

 

In his address to the group, Hj Bujang praised members for their contribution towards establishing a sound ICT foundation to strengthen all subjects of the curriculum. He emphasised that there will be a need for dedicated teachers to bind together to build programs that enhance the learning through technology.

 

Mr Chong said that 14 recommendations based on the educational visit to Singapore had now been forwarded to the MOE for consideration towards successful implementation of ICT across the curriculum for Brunei schools. Mr Chong's concluding remarks were to promise that there would be a large number of in-service training courses organised for teachers throughout the country in 2002 by the ICT Secondary School Based Committee.
